Cleaning UPVC windows

Cleaning UPVC windows requires the use of proper tools. If you choose the wrong cleaning products, they could cause irreparable damage to your windows. These tips will assist you in avoiding this.

A vacuum cleaner that has a an attachment for a soft bristle can be used to clean your uPVC windows frames. This helps to remove the dust and dirt that may build up on the hinges. You should also wash the interiors of your uPVC windows using a non-smear cleaning agent.

For wiping down your uPVC window frames, soft, lint-free white towels are ideal. They should be replaced as soon as they get dirty.

A microfibre cloth is an option. These cloths are gentle, scratch-proof, and help bring back the shine to your uPVC.

You may require a cream cleaner in the event that your uPVC windows have a discoloration. Apply the solution to one small area and allow it to soak for a few minutes. Once this process is complete then you need to wipe the surface with a dry, clean cloth.

A mixture of water and vinegar can also be used. It can be sprayed on the area and left for ten minutes. This will remove dirt and debris and make it easier to clean up. After some time, wash your window and wipe clean using a clean, dry rag.

Cleaning your repairing upvc windows windows should never be done using pads with abrasive properties. Abrasive pads can cause damage to the uPVC's glossy exterior. In addition, if try to clean a stain with an abrasive solution that is permanent, it could ruin the shine of your uPVC window.

A cloudy or fogging-looking window could indicate a broken seal. This is a typical issue that is often caused by an unsound seal. There are a variety of ways you can repair this. First, you need to know how to fix a broken window seal. Then, you'll need to know how to prevent it happening again.

If you have a double-paned window it is possible to replace the sash to resolve the issue. This is only temporary. In the end, you'll have to replace the entire window. Each window will cost between $200 and $400.

The windows that are hazy are caused by a range of various issues. They can be caused by a faulty seal, moisture between the panes or rotting wooden frames. But, the most frequent cause of a cloudy window is a damaged seal.

Clean the frame and panes to fix the air gap that is damaged. This can be challenging due to the gaps between the panes. To remove moisture that is not needed, it is recommended that you make use of dehumidifiers.
